River's Edge Cape Knitting Pattern
Description
This cozy cape will keep you warm and stylish on any outdoor adventure. The textured stitch pattern resembles flowing river currents, making it a unique and eye-catching piece.
Materials
- Yarn: 4 skeins of worsted weight yarn (200g/skein, approx. 450 yards/skein)
- Needles: US 8 / UK 6 / 5mm circular knitting needles
- Cable needle
- Stitch markers
- Tapestry needle
Gauge
20 stitches x 24 rows = 4 inches in stockinette stitch
Size
One size fits all
